The Home Care transportation program offers older adults a reliable and convenient non-emergency medical transportation service. This program provides various transportation options, including taxi services and private car rides. Riders can schedule their trips in advance, ensuring a smooth and timely experience. With the option to pay through insurance, vouchers, donations, or a membership fee, this program offers flexibility in payment methods. Additionally, Home Care is a paratransit service that caters to older adults with specific mobility needs. It provides assistance with packages or bags and allows for on-demand scheduling for shared rides. The program ensures comfort and convenience by offering door-to-door or curb-to-curb transportation services, following fixed routes for efficiency. Riders utilizing the Home Care program can expect professional and accommodating services, with the option to pay via various methods such as cash, credit card, check, or pre-payment. With a focus on meeting the transportation needs of older adults, this program prioritizes safety, reliability, and accessibility for its users, including accommodating service animals when needed.
